Joel Deacon is the Planting Pastor of City on a Hill Wollongong. He is firmly convinced that we are designed for community, especially in a big and sometimes lonely city like Wollongong. Before becoming a pastor, Joel worked as a Civil Engineer and is always up for a chat about roads and bridges. But his greatest passion is talking to people about Jesus. Joel is married to Emma, and they have three kids Elijah, Isaac and Lily. An ideal day off for Joel would include coffee with his wife, smelling flowers with his daughter, wrestling with his boys, reading, and staying up late to watch EPL.
Catherine is the Children’s Worker at City on a Hill Wollongong. She has a passion for serving and teaching children about Jesus. She loves connecting with families, especially over a cuppa and serving them in any way she can.
City on a Hill is one movement of men and women gathered across eight churches, in five cities, united around the mission "to know Jesus and make Jesus known".
